United Kingdom - Share of CO2 Emissions from Road in Total CO2 Emissions from Transport
Since 2014, United Kingdom Share of CO2 Emissions from Road in Total CO2 Emissions from Transport was down by 0.2points year on year. At 93.89 Percent in 2019, the country was ranked number 33 among other countries in Share of CO2 Emissions from Road in Total CO2 Emissions from Transport. United Kingdom is overtaken by France, which was ranked number 32 at 94.28 Percent and is followed by Iceland with 93.88 Percent. Montenegro lead the ranking with 100.07 Percent in 2019, that is an increase of 0.1points versus 2018. Macedonia, Slovenia and Israel resp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ukraine recorded the best 5 years average growth at +1.7points per year, while Azerbaijan was the worst growing country at -2points per year.
